R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Play a large role in creating the annual budgets for all owned assets in the OakPoint portfolio. Coordinating with asset managers, property managers, and OakPoint partners to meet deadlines and ensure accuracy of budgets.
  • Working with the VP Finance and asset managers, create the quarterly reports for all owned assets for distribution to investors in a timely manner.
  • Generate monthly financial reports for each owned asset showing variances to budget with explanations for review by OakPoint partners.
  • Analyze lease transactions, perform tenant credit review as needed, and assist asset managers and partners in the preparation of lease agreements.
  • Create and maintain financial models for leasing, sell/hold, refinance and other ad hoc analyses on existing portfolio of investments.
  • Assist in disposition or refinance process, including preparation of return metrics and sales/refinance rationale, interfacing with brokers and legal counsel, and coordinating closing and post-closing efforts.
  • Coordinate communications to investors regarding capital calls, performance of assets, and distributions via email and Juniper Square software.
  • Review, analyze, comprehend, abstract and interpret various types of real estate documents, including leases, rent rolls, budgets, operating statements, expense recovery reconciliations, loan agreements, purchase and sale agreements, and other information.
